Background:

This gene encodes a PDZ-domain-containing protein that belongs to a family of Shroom-related proteins. This protein may be involved in regulating cell shape in certain tissues. A similar protein in mice is required for proper neurulation. [provided by RefSeq, Jan 2011],

Cellular LocalizationCell junction, adherens junction . Cytoplasm, cytoskeleton . Apical cell membrane; Peripheral membrane protein . Colocalizes with F-actin in stress fibers and adherens junctions. .

FunctionDomain:The ASD1 domain mediates F-actin binding.,Domain:The ASD2 domain is required for apical constriction induction.,Function:Controls cell shape changes in the neuroepithelium during neural tube closure. Induces apical constriction in epithelial cells by promoting the apical accumulation of F-actin and myosin II, and probably by bundling stress fibers. Induces apicobasal cell elongation by redistributing gamma-tubulin and directing the assembly of robust apicobasal microtubule arrays.,similarity:Belongs to the shroom family.,similarity:Contains 1 ASD1 domain.,similarity:Contains 1 ASD2 domain.,similarity:Contains 1 PDZ (DHR) domain.,subcellular location:Colocalizes with F-actin in stress fibers and adherens junctions.,subunit:Interacts with F-actin.,
